What are FRP Rods?
FRP rods are composite materials created by combining a polymer matrix with fiber reinforcements, typically glass or carbon fibers. This combination results in a material that is not only lightweight but also exhibits high tensile strength, corrosion resistance, and durability. These attributes make FRP rods suitable for applications that require long-lasting, resilient materials, such as in reinforcing concrete structures, creating lightweight components for vehicles, or manufacturing complex, high-performance parts in the aerospace sector.

Benefits of FRP Rods
The advantages of FRP rods over traditional materials like steel or aluminum are manifold. First and foremost, their lightweight nature reduces transportation costs and makes installation easier, especially in challenging environments. Additionally, FRP rods are resistant to corrosion, which significantly extends their service life when used in harsh conditions, such as marine or chemical environments.
Moreover, FRP rods exhibit excellent electrical insulation properties, making them ideal for use in electrical applications. They can also withstand extreme temperatures and are less prone to fatigue, which enhances the overall performance of structures and components.
